backgo to search

senior javascript developer for a multinational software company

bullets
JavaScript, TypeScript, API & Integration Platforms

We're looking for a remote Senior Developer with strong experience with exceptional knowledge of modern frontend technology stacks to join our team.

The customer is a German multinational software corporation that makes enterprise software to manage business operations and customer relations.

responsibilities
  • Design, develop, and roll out solutions using the modern technology stack
    • Work with the user interface, technology integration, and back-end API systems
      • Lead the development team and communicate on a daily basis
        • Release estimation, planning, and timely integration with other stakeholders (product, app, backend, ui/ux, etc.)
          • Performance fixes and optimization
            • Continuous discovery, evaluation, and implementation new best practices to maximize the development quality and efficiency
              • Ability to provide and follow best practices for developers: good coding habits, code reviews, pep8 standards for syntax, styling, comments
                • Build highly scalable and reliable web application with high standards for security leverage state-of-the-art technology stacks and tooling
                  requirements
                  • 3+ years of previous experience in development and operations, or related IT, computer, or operations field
                    • Strong sense for quality assurance and experience designing and implementing function tests as part of development process. Familiar with Jasmine, Jest, Selenium, Mocha
                      • Exceptional knowledge of modern frontend technology stacks, including JavaScript, Typescript, client side component oriented frameworks and libraries
                        • Familiar with a modern web development architecture based on client side JavaScript like React.js, reusable APIs (e.g. Twilio, Stripe) and prebuild Markup (e.g. Gtsby.js, Webpack)
                          • Experience with Domain Driven Design, Event Storming and other microservice techniques
                            • Experience with GitHub, Jira and other agile tools
                              • Experience with API-first design principle and tools like Swagger
                                • Proficient English (written and spoken) B2
                                  nice to have
                                  • Knowledge in micro-frontend pattern
                                    • Knowledge in GraphQL

                                      benefits for locations

                                      location.svg
                                      For you
                                      • Insurance Coverage 
                                      • Paid Leaves – including maternity, bereavement, paternity, and special COVID-19 leaves. 
                                      • Financial assistance for medical crisis 
                                      • Retiral Benefits – VPF and NPS 
                                      • Customized Mindfulness and Wellness programs 
                                      • EPAM Hobby Clubs
                                      For your comfortable work
                                      • Hybrid Work Model 
                                      • Soft loans to set up workspace at home 
                                      • Stable workload 
                                      • Relocation opportunities with ‘EPAM without Borders’ program

                                      For your growth
                                      • Certification trainings for technical and soft skills 
                                      • Access to unlimited LinkedIn Learning platform 
                                      • Access to internal learning programs set up by world class trainers 
                                      • Community networking and idea creation platforms 
                                      • Mentorship programs 
                                      • Self-driven career progression tool

                                      get job alerts in your inboxHundreds of open jobs for Software Engineers, QA, DevOps, Business Analysts and other tech professionals
                                      Girl in front of laptop
                                      looking for something else?

                                      Find a vacancy that works for you. Send us your CV to receive a personalized offer.